The Role of Standards in Defining Size The reliability of size measurements depends entirely on universally accepted standards that eliminate ambiguity.
Size as a concept operates as one of the most fundamental yet frequently misunderstood dimensions of measurement in both physical and abstract contexts. At its core, size quantifies the dimensions, magnitude, or extent of an entity, providing a standardized method to communicate scale.
